Bitcoin Holds $88K Amid Regulatory and Institutional Support
Bitcoin (BTC) has demonstrated resilience, maintaining its position around the $88,000 mark as regulatory developments and institutional interest provide strong tailwinds. Several US states have taken proactive steps to advance crypto-friendly policies, fostering a more supportive environment for digital assets. Meanwhile, corporations and institutional investors continue to accumulate BTC, reinforcing confidence in its long-term value proposition.
State-Level Crypto Policies Fuel Market Optimism
Recent legislative moves in states like Texas, Florida, and Wyoming have bolstered Bitcoin’s legitimacy as a financial asset. These regions are implementing frameworks to accommodate crypto businesses, tax incentives, and even Bitcoin mining operations. Such policies reduce regulatory uncertainty, making Bitcoin more attractive to both retail and institutional investors.
Institutional Demand Strengthens BTC’s Foundation
Institutional adoption remains a key driver of Bitcoin’s price stability. Major firms, including publicly traded companies and hedge funds, have been steadily increasing their BTC holdings. This trend signals growing trust in Bitcoin as a store of value and hedge against inflation, particularly amid macroeconomic uncertainties.
Technical Analysis: Consolidation Before a Breakout?
From a technical perspective, Bitcoin’s price action is showing signs of tightening consolidation. Bollinger Bands are narrowing, and the Relative Strength Index (RSI) hovers near neutral levels, indicating neither overbought nor oversold conditions. Traders are closely watching for a decisive breakout above $90K or a potential pullback toward support levels near $85K.
